Studying binary stars is an excellent way to teach middle and high school science because it shows students that much of the universe operates through interacting systems, not isolated objects, and it makes gravity, motion, and light measurable in a real and fascinating context. Binary star systems help students understand orbits, forces, and centripetal motion, reveal how scientists use Doppler shift and changes in brightness to infer unseen objects, and provide a clear pathway into big ideas like mass, density, energy transfer, and stellar evolution, including dramatic outcomes such as supernovae, neutron stars, and black holes.
